DISCERNING
\dɪsˈɜːnɪŋ], \dɪsˈɜːnɪŋ], \d_ɪ_s_ˈɜː_n_ɪ_ŋ]\
Sort: Oldest first
-
having or revealing keen insight and good judgment; "a discerning critic"; "a discerning reader"
-
able to make or detect effects of great subtlety; sensitive; "discerning taste"; "a discerning eye for color"
By Princeton University
